Mashed Potato Muffins
Ready In: 1 hr 10 mins
Serves: 6
Ingredients
- 1 lb potato, peeled and quartered
- 2 tablespoons milk
- 1 tablespoon butter
- 1⁄4 teaspoon salt
- 1⁄3 cup sour cream
- 1⁄3 cup ricotta cheese
- 1 egg, beaten
- 3 green onions, finely chopped (optional)
Directions
- Place the potatoes in a large saucepan and cover with water.
- Bring to a boil.
- Reduce heat and cover and cook for 20-25 minutes or until tender.
- Drain and place potatoes in a large mixing bowl.
- Add the milk, butter and salt.
- Mash until light and fluffy.
- Fold in the sour cream, ricotta cheese, egg and onions.
- GENEROUSLY coat six muffin cups with nonstick cooking spray.
- Fill with potato mixture and smooth tops.
- Bake at 375 degrees for 20-25 minutes or until edges are lightly browned.
- Cool for 5 minutes.
- Carefully run a knife around the edge of each muffin cup and invert onto a baking sheet or serving platter.
